Camden Property Trust

Camden Property Trust, an S&P 500 Company, is a real estate company primarily engaged in the ownership, management, development, redevelopment, acquisition, and construction of multifamily apartment communities. Camden owns and operates 173 properties containing 58,811 apartment homes across the United States. Upon completion of 3 properties currently under development, the Company's portfolio will increase to 59,973 apartment homes in 176 properties. Camden Property Trust was established on May 25, 1993, and incorporated in Texas. Camden Property Trust is based in Houston, United States.
